Management of the Avulsed Tooth / Class V fracture
Management of the Avulsed Tooth
• Ultimate goal– PDL healing without
root resorption
• Most critical factor– Maintaining an intact
and viable PDL on the root surface
Emergency Treatment
• Replantation technique– Local anesthetic, if
necessary– Radiograph to verify
position– Check occlusion– Physiologic splint

Root Surface Manipulation
• Extraoral dry time determines handling
Root Surface Manipulation
• Extraoral dry time < 1 hr– PDL healing is still possible– Handling recommendations
• Keep root moist• Do not handle root surface• Gentle debridement
Root Surface Manipulation
• Extraoral dry time > 1 hr– Loss of PDL cell viability
inevitable – Treatment
recommendations• Remove tissue tags• Soak in accepted dental
fluoride solution for 20 min
Fluoride Treatment
• 1.0-2.4% topical fluoride solution– Sodium fluoride
(Andreasen)– Stannous fluoride
(Krasner)
• 20 minute soak
Management of the Socket
• Remove contaminated coagulum in socket– Irrigate with sterile saline
Management of the Socket
• Examine socket If fracture is evident – Reposition fractured bone with a blunt instrument
Management of the Socket
• Replant using light digital pressure

Class VII
• Subluxation Definition: injury to tooth-supporting structures with abnormal loosening but without tooth displacement.
Th/ : Permanent teeth: Stabilize the tooth and relieve any occlusal interferences. For comfort, a flexible splint can be used. Splint for no more than 2 weeks.
• Lateral luxation Definition: displacement of the tooth in a direction other than
axially. The periodontal ligament is torn and contusion or fracture of the supporting alveolar bone occurs
Emergancy treatment for Permanent teeth: - Local anasthetic- to reposition as soon as possible and then to stabilize the tooth
in its anatomically correct position to optimize healing of the periodontal ligament and neurovascular supply while maintaining esthetic and functional integrity. Repositioning of the tooth is done with digital pressure and little force. A displaced tooth may need to be extruded to free itself from the apical lock in the cortical bone plate.
- Splinting an additional 2 to 4 weeks may be needed with breakdown of marginal bone
• Intrusion Definition: apical displacement of tooth into the alveolar bone. The tooth is driven into the socket, compressing the periodontal ligament and commonly causes a crushing fracture of the alveolar socket
Emergency treatment:- For immature teeth with more eruptive
potential (root ½ to ²/³ formed): Clean the wound with NaCl, H2O2 and
anticeptic solution spontaneous eruption
In mature teeth:• Clean the wound with NaCl, H2O2 and anticeptic
solution• Local Anesthetic • reposition the tooth with orthodontic or surgical
extrusion (local anesthetic if nescessery)• stabilize the tooth with a splint for up to 4 weeks in its
anatomically correct position to optimize healing of the periodontal ligament and neurovascular supply while maintaining esthetic and functional integrity.
• Extrusion Definition: partial displacement of the tooth axially from the socket; partial avulsion. The periodontal ligament usually is tornPermanent teeth:
- Clean the wound with NaCl, H2O2 and anticeptic solution- Give Local Anesthetic.- Using fingers, grab extruded teeth and surrounding alveolus
then reposition teeth and attached bone all together.- After repositioning, splint with attention to bite relationship
stabilize the tooth in its anatomically correct position to optimize healing of the periodontal ligament and neurovascular supply while maintaining esthetic and functional integrity. Splint for up to 2 weeks
Class VIII: Crown and Root Fracture
• Enamel, dentin, and cementum fracture with or without pulp exposure
Emergency treatment :Permanent teeth: - Clean wound- Local Anesthetic- If the pulp is exposed, pulpal treatment alternatives are
pulp capping, pulpotomy, and root canal treatment.- Reattached fracture fragmen stabilize the coronal fragment.
or necessary gingivectomy; osteotomy; or surgical or orthodontic extrusion to prepare for restoration.
Emergency Treatment for dental trauma in primary Teeth
• Crown fracture with pulp involvement (vital)- Clean wound- Local Anesthetic- Perform Pulpotomy or pulpectomy• Root fracture ―Apical third : observation―Cervical third and midle third :
― Local anasthetic― Extraction
• Crown/root fracture :– Local anesthetic– The entire tooth should be removed unless
retrieval of apical fragments may result in damage to the succedaneous tooth
Displacement
• Lateral luxation Primary teeth:
- to allow passive or spontaneous repositiong if there is no occlusal interference.
- When there is occlusal interference, local anestheticthe tooth can be gently repositioned or slightly reduced if the interference is minor.
- When the injury is severe or the tooth is nearing exfoliation, local anesthetic extraction is the treatment of choice
• Intrusion : – Reeruption spontaneuly– Dammage to premanent teeth extraction
• Extrusion– Local Anesthetic– reposition spontaneously or reposition and allow
for healing for minor extrusion (<3 mm) in an immature developing tooth.
– Indications for an extraction include severe extrusion or mobility, the tooth is nearing exfoliation, the child’s inability to cope with the emergency situation
